Ergo F93 stock
Vision Armory 80% lower with generic lpk , and polished trigger
Spartan Side Charge Non-Reciprocating Billet Upper  
Nickel Boron BCG
Black hole weaponry 18" mid length barrel 1:8 twist
Sentry 7 Clamp On Premium Adjustable Gas Block
Yankee Hill Machine 10" Slant nose FF handguard
Yankee Hill Machine Slant nose muzzle brake
